Changeset 14927 for branches/PersistenceReintegration/HeuristicLab.Algorithms.DataAnalysis/3.4/MctsSymbolicRegression/Policies
- Timestamp:
- 05/04/17 17:19:35 (8 years ago)
- Location:
- branches/PersistenceReintegration/HeuristicLab.Algorithms.DataAnalysis/3.4/MctsSymbolicRegression/Policies
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/PersistenceReintegration/HeuristicLab.Algorithms.DataAnalysis/3.4/MctsSymbolicRegression/Policies/EpsGreedy.cs
r13669 r14927 9 9 using HeuristicLab.Data; 10 10 using HeuristicLab.Parameters; 11 using HeuristicLab.Persistence .Default.CompositeSerializers.Storable;11 using HeuristicLab.Persistence; 12 12 13 13 namespace HeuristicLab.Algorithms.DataAnalysis.MctsSymbolicRegression.Policies { 14 [Storable Class]14 [StorableType("1a6465df-509f-4977-a9fc-fcf4e420fb5d")] 15 15 [Item("EpsilonGreedy", "Epsilon greedy policy with parameter eps to balance between exploitation and exploration")] 16 16 public class EpsilonGreedy : PolicyBase { -
branches/PersistenceReintegration/HeuristicLab.Algorithms.DataAnalysis/3.4/MctsSymbolicRegression/Policies/PolicyBase.cs
r13669 r14927 7 7 using HeuristicLab.Common; 8 8 using HeuristicLab.Core; 9 using HeuristicLab.Persistence .Default.CompositeSerializers.Storable;9 using HeuristicLab.Persistence; 10 10 11 11 namespace HeuristicLab.Algorithms.DataAnalysis.MctsSymbolicRegression.Policies { 12 [Storable Class]12 [StorableType("d2a06cc9-6b72-47aa-9d41-4aa814d002d9")] 13 13 public abstract class PolicyBase : Item, IParameterizedItem, IPolicy { 14 14 [Storable] -
branches/PersistenceReintegration/HeuristicLab.Algorithms.DataAnalysis/3.4/MctsSymbolicRegression/Policies/Ucb.cs
r13669 r14927 9 9 using HeuristicLab.Data; 10 10 using HeuristicLab.Parameters; 11 using HeuristicLab.Persistence .Default.CompositeSerializers.Storable;11 using HeuristicLab.Persistence; 12 12 13 13 namespace HeuristicLab.Algorithms.DataAnalysis.MctsSymbolicRegression.Policies { 14 [Storable Class]14 [StorableType("70d954bb-7e36-40d2-a1e9-17f955f02ed5")] 15 15 [Item("Ucb Policy", "Ucb with parameter c to balance between exploitation and exploration")] 16 16 public class Ucb : PolicyBase { -
branches/PersistenceReintegration/HeuristicLab.Algorithms.DataAnalysis/3.4/MctsSymbolicRegression/Policies/UcbTuned.cs
r13669 r14927 9 9 using HeuristicLab.Data; 10 10 using HeuristicLab.Parameters; 11 using HeuristicLab.Persistence .Default.CompositeSerializers.Storable;11 using HeuristicLab.Persistence; 12 12 13 13 namespace HeuristicLab.Algorithms.DataAnalysis.MctsSymbolicRegression.Policies { 14 [Storable Class]14 [StorableType("20805399-3b19-4a46-befa-8600bdc566eb")] 15 15 [Item("UcbTuned Policy", "UcbTuned is similar to Ucb but tracks empirical variance. Use parameter c to balance between exploitation and exploration")] 16 16 public class UcbTuned : PolicyBase {
Note: See TracChangeset
for help on using the changeset viewer.